1. Crafting a Meaningful Departure Message 📝
A farewell email is more than just a notification of an employee's departure; it is a final opportunity to recognize teams and individuals who contributed to one's journey. Crafting a thoughtful message can impact company culture, morale, and future collaborations. The departure should articulate appreciation and highlight shared achievements. A well-written email fosters good relationships and leaves the door open for future interactions.
2. Reflecting on Achievements and Lessons Learned 📈
When composing a farewell email, it is essential to reflect on both personal and collective milestones attained during one's tenure. An employee might outline the significant changes and advancements that occurred during their time. For example, mentioning product evolutions, drastic improvements in revenue, or innovative strategies introduced can forcefully convey the value they brought to the organization. Sharing key lessons learned from colleagues can also add depth to the message, showcasing growth from collaboration and shared challenges.
Key Elements to Address:
- Product Developments: Discuss any major transformations in the service or product lines that arose during tenure.
- Business Progress: Provide statistics or qualitative insights into the company’s growth trajectory.
- Team Dynamics: Acknowledge the collective experience working among diverse teams, stressing values and support systems.
- Cultural Contributions: Evoke the core company values and how they were embodied in daily activities.
3. Leaving a Lasting Impression on Company Culture 🌟
A farewell email presents an excellent opportunity to underscore the organization's culture. A departing employee might reflect on how they contributed to or benefited from existing values. For instance, they may emphasize the importance of humility, teamwork, or a customer-first mindset. By doing so, they reinforce the idea that the corporate culture is dynamic and evolves through active participation from all employees.
Suggested Approaches:
- Highlight Company Values: Clearly articulate the core values and how they grew during the employee's term. This can inspire remaining employees to uphold and foster those values.
- Encourage Ongoing Data-Driven Practices: If relevant, reinforce principles like continuous improvement (e.g., through A/B testing) which can stimulate ongoing innovation and adaptability within the team.
- Foster a Legacy of Communication: Encourage an environment where open dialogue and mutual support persist even after one’s departure.
4. Invitation for Continuous Connection 🤝
A farewell email should also promote the idea of ongoing connections. Offering personal contact information is a meaningful gesture that emphasizes the potential for future collaboration and friendship. Indicating interest in remaining engaged with the company signifies respect and value for the relationships established. Making oneself approachable for future inquiries or shared experiences nurtures a sense of community and continuity.
Suggestions to Enhance Connectivity:
- Personal Contacts: Share updated contact details to facilitate future communication.
- Encourage LinkedIn Connections: Suggest connecting via professional platforms to keep the network alive.
